Cauliflower Pizza, Anthony's Coal Fired Pizza 

Come to Anthony's with a big group and be prepared to share. The pies are huge. The best on their menu is the roasted cauliflower pizza, which includes a crunchy crust, mozzarella, Romano cheese, bread crumbs, and roasted cauliflower. This pizza is a clever way to get kids to eat veggies. There are locations throughout Suffolk and Nassau county. 

Classic Cold Cheese Pizza, Little Vincents

Little V's specialty cold pizza slice is loved by many Long Islanders. The cold mozzarella cheese melts on the warm crispy pizza for a creamy and enjoyable bite. 

S'mores Pizza, Red Tomato 

Dessert for dinner always sounds good. This pie has the power to make your day. The thin crust with Nutella and toasted marshmallows on top is made for sharing. 

Tomato Soup Grilled Cheese Pizza, Phil's 2 Pizza  

Phil's 2 Pizza offers a wide selection of extravagant pizza. The grilled cheese and tomato soup pizza is a match made in pizza heaven. The gooey cheese bites and the rich tomato flavor topped with fresh basil is the perfect comfort food.
